Transaction e659b055277f7795b906345d39e2aa54150bc17e30211e9a45392d4ca84d763a
1 Input
1 Output
-
e659b055277f7795b906345d39e2aa54150bc17e30211e9a45392d4ca84d763a:0
- value
- 123930
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 daf840540d59e024f45ffd1a7ff7bd414b67dbff OP_EQUAL
- address
- 3MepdAUv8cPiXUTh2D3HsWhfjrHMJV8T52